Question
A magnet is suspended so that it may oscillate in the horizontal plane. It performs 20 oscillations per minute at a place where the angle of dip is 30° and 15 oscillations per minute, where the angle of dip is 60°. Compare the earth’s total magnetic field at these two places.
Solution
Magnet is suspended such that it oscillates in horizonal plane.
When, angle of dip is 30o , magnet performs 20 oscillations per minute.
and,
When angle of dip is 60o , it performs 15 oscillations per minute.
Frequency of oscillation is given by,
